Plant cells have a cell wall, chloroplasts, plasmodesmata, and plastids used for storage, and a large central vacuole, whereas animal cells do not. Like plant cells, animal cells have a cell membrane. They all have nuclei, cell membranes, and organelles (er, golgi, ribosomes, and mitochondria). Plant cells have large vacuoles to store large amounts of water, they have cell walls unlike animal cells that provide structure for the plant and contain chlorophyl, and they have chloroplasts which also contain chlorophyl and are where photosynthesis takes place.
